Taipei World Trade Center Nangang Exhibition Hall (TWTC Nangang) is a superimposed purpose-built exhibition complex in Nangang, Taipei, which consists of two exhibition halls one over the other. It is located to the east of the Taipei World Trade Center (TWTC), about 15 minutes drive from the TWTC along the Huangdong Expressway. Space Usage of Floors This complex, Taiwans largest trade-show venue has the capacity to host 2,467 standard-size (3x3 meters) booths and occupies an exhibition space of 45,360 square meters. Construction began in March 2005, costing US$ 110 million, and opened in March 2008.

The Wufenpu Garment District, thats where! Its laid out before Songshan Railway Station; on the north side is Songlong Rd., on the south is Yongji Rd., on the west is Songshan Rd., on the east Zhongpo N. Rd. In this concentrated area are stuffed with more than 1,000 outlets selling fashionable clothing and accessories from Taiwan, Hong Kong, Japan, Korea, and other countries. Raohe Street Night Market is the very first night market in Taiwan. Its public facilities and managerial capacity are well maintained and developed. There are fully functional Board of the Raohe Street Tourist Night Market and communal facilities besides various characteristic snacks which are renowned at home and abroad. Tidy, comfortable, quality goods, reasonable prices, and customer service, are the goals of the Raohe Street Night Market. These elements are the essences of its Owl logo - the later it gets, the more beautiful it becomes.
